What should you do before welding?

Explanation:
Before welding, you should read and understand the instructions with the mold. This ensures you know exactly how the mold should be set up, what joint and weld process to use, and any required steps like cleaning surfaces, securing clamps, and setting heat, speed, and safety measures. Following the instructions helps ensure a proper fit and weld quality, and it protects you from hazards by applying the correct procedures. Jumping in without this review can lead to incorrect settings, weak or defective welds, and potential injuries. Moving the mold or skipping the instructions can cause misalignment or unsafe conditions, so always confirm everything is clearly understood and prepared before starting.
